Ported heads ?
Im looking locally at a set of slp cnc ported heads with stock sized valves. The intake valves are the sodium filled zo6's. Guy said hes going turbo and has some 317's to replace them thats the reason for sale. I was just wondering if they are worth the 475 he's asking and has anyone else had ported heads from slp with good results on a dd car. Im also thinking about just a cam and was wondering if its a good idea or wasted money to replace the lifters on a high mile engine thats in really good shape? I have heard they develop a wear pattern in the lifter trays thats where my concern comes into play, not the pattern on the rollers themselves. Thanks.

If the motor has miles on it then change the lifters, we are only talking about $200 or so for LS7 lifters. Trays should get changed to LS2 style which are better and cost hardly nothing. The heads I'm not sure about, you should try to get flow numbers for them. THe lightweight valves are nice but without knowing the CC (Mill) or the Flow numbers, it could be a rip off or a hell of a good deal.
